How do trees regrow after cutting
When a tree is cut down its roots are left in the ground, and it is possible for new shoots to grow from the root system. This process is referred to as coppicing. It is a survival method employed by certain species of trees. Coppicing helps trees grow after being cut down or damaged, and it provides an opportunity to grow new to the trees.
Factors that affect tree growth
The capacity of a tree to regrow after being cut down is dependent on many variables, such as the tree’s species, the size of the tree, and the health of its root system. Certain tree species like willows or birches, are more likely to regrow after being cut, while others, like oak trees tend to not do so. The dimensions of the tree and the health of the root system have a major impact on determining whether a tree will grow.
Tree Species
Trees that are known for their ability to re-grow after being cut include willows, birches, and poplars. These species have a fast-growing root system, and are capable of establishing new shoots quickly. However oak trees and other species that slow grow tend to not grow back after cutting.
Tree Size
The larger the tree, the more challenging it is to re-grow it after it has been cut down. This is due to the fact that the tree’s root system grows more extensive as the tree grows which makes it harder in the beginning for new branches to emerge.
Root System Health
The health of the tree’s root system is another important factor in the determination of whether it will grow after it has been cut. When the roots are damaged, or ill, it may become difficult to re-grow.
The pros and cons of Tree Regrowth
Although tree regrowth is beneficial however, it has drawbacks. On the one hand, regrowth can provide the opportunity to create new growth for trees which allows it to continue providing benefits to the natural environment. However it can also create new safety risks, especially when the tree is situated near buildings or power lines.
Benefits of Tree Regrowth
Creates new growth for the tree . It continues to provide benefits to the environment, such as shade and oxygen. It can also improve the look of an area
The cons of tree regrowth
It could cause new safety concerns, especially in the case of trees that are located near power lines or structures. Can be a nuisance when it grows again in an unwanted location Can be difficult to remove the regrown tree without damage to the root system.
